blob: 182663ece5b96be902663c75b1c820cd5f90d847 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
|
From 1e1afa48034869d4a1520c405b56c3a574b3f4ba Mon Sep 17 00:00:00 2001
From: Anil Kumar M <amamidal@xilinx.com>
Date: Mon, 24 Feb 2020 14:45:46 +0530
Subject: [PATCH] v4l-utils: Add support for new media bus codes
Add new media bus format codes for supporting xilinx
specific formats.
Signed-off-by: Anil Kumar M <amamidal@xilinx.com>
Signed-off-by: Adrian Fiergolski <Adrian.Fiergolski@fastree3d.com>
---
include/linux/media-bus-format.h | 11 +++++++++++
1 file changed, 11 insertions(+)
diff --git a/include/linux/media-bus-format.h b/include/linux/media-bus-format.h
index f05f747e..45f6707d 100644
--- a/include/linux/media-bus-format.h
+++ b/include/linux/media-bus-format.h
@@ -121,6 +121,17 @@
#define MEDIA_BUS_FMT_YUV16_1X48 0x202a
#define MEDIA_BUS_FMT_UYYVYY16_0_5X48 0x202b
+/* YUV: Xilinx Specific - next is 0x2108 */
+#define MEDIA_BUS_FMT_VYYUYY8_1X24 0x2100
+#define MEDIA_BUS_FMT_VYYUYY10_4X20 0x2101
+#define MEDIA_BUS_FMT_VUY10_1X30 0x2102
+#define MEDIA_BUS_FMT_UYYVYY12_4X24 0x2103
+#define MEDIA_BUS_FMT_VUY12_1X36 0x2104
+#define MEDIA_BUS_FMT_UYYVYY16_4X32 0x2105
+#define MEDIA_BUS_FMT_VUY16_1X48 0x2106
+#define MEDIA_BUS_FMT_UYVY16_2X32 0x2107
+
+
/* Bayer - next is 0x3021 */
#define MEDIA_BUS_FMT_SBGGR8_1X8 0x3001
#define MEDIA_BUS_FMT_SGBRG8_1X8 0x3013
--
2.34.1
|